Per the jacket blurb, this anthology of "new stories of the macabre" consists of "18 stories never before published." (Well, except that the American (Arkham House) edition had appeared three years earlier.) Contents: "The Crew of the Lancing" (William Hope Hodgson); "The Last Meeting of Two Old Friends" (H. Russell Wakefield); "The Shadow in the Attic" (H.P. Lovecraft); "The Renegade" (John Metcalfe); "Told in the Desert" (Clark Ashton Smith); "When the Rains Came" (Frank Belknap Long); "The Blue Flame of Vengeance" (Robert E. Howard); "Crabgass" (Jesse Stuart); "Kincaid's Car" (Carl Jacobi); "The Patchwork Quilt" (August Derleth); "The Black Gondolier" (Fritz Leiber); "The Old Lady's Room" (J. Vernon Shea); "The North Knoll" (Joseph Payne Brennan); "The Huaco of Señor Peréz" (Mary Elizabeth Conselman); "Mr. Alucard" (David A. Johnstone); "Casting the Stone" (John Pocsik); "Aneanoshian" (Michael Bailey); "The Stone on the Island" (J. Ramsey Campbell).

Description: One of 3,045 copies printed. Wilson criticized Lovecraft in his treatise "The Strength to Dream," so August Derleth challenged him to write his own fantasy novel. In response, Wilson wrote this book imitating Lovecraft's style. Joshi, 92. A complete file of the house organ of Arkham House, internationally known for their publications in the science fiction, fantasy and horror genres. A wealth of historical and bibliographical data on the books and their authors as well as short fiction and poetry by H. P. Lovecraft, Clark Ashton Smith, Robert E. Howard, L. Sprague de Camp, August Derleth, and others.
